The latest Util.js Document
Certain functionalities can be utilized all over profiles of your Javascript speak app including showing otherwise covering up the packing indication or score every piece of information of your own validated representative. To eliminate duplicated password, you need to shop all of the common functionalities in one file, as well as in this situation, which document is known as “util.js”. A full provider password can receive here.
Brand new Sign on.js http://www.datingmentor.org/pl/elite-randki File
The latest document needs duty having handling the providers logic getting the new log on webpage. So it file consists of services that can let the representative sign in a good the fresh new membership or log in to the application form. A complete source code is available from here. Once pressing the newest indication-upwards button, brand new “registerNewAccount” setting will be triggered. It accepts good JSON target due to the fact a factor and JSON target gets the owner’s pointers like the customer’s email address, user’s code, owner’s avatar, user’s years, customer’s intercourse, and you will customer’s name. Before continuing that have subsequent actions, the newest user’s information has to be confirmed utilising the “validateNewAccount” function. In case the info is legitimate, a separate account might possibly be created by getting in touch with the newest perform user API. After that, the program reports a merchant account into CometChat by using the CometChat JS SDK. You could consider new less than code snippet to find out more.
This new less than password snippet identifies how to handle the business logic towards the signal-during the ability. the user’s back ground was taken from the fresh new enter in aspects earliest and the software validates you to definitely suggestions. In the event your input info is valid, the application commonly let the user sign in using the Sign on API. In addition to that, new authenticated member will be redirected into the webpage.
The home Page
Adopting the associate has logged into the app, an individual would be redirected on the website and on this site, you plan to use CometChat JS SDK to build the application. To manufacture our home web page, you need to proceed with the below steps:
- 1: Do index.html document on your investment folder. The full resource password exists here.
Perhaps you have realized with the password snippet more than, you need to include the latest CometChat JS SDK regarding CDN just like the we wish to put the brand new chat feature, and you can sound/videos contacting regarding Tinder duplicate. From there, jQuery, and you can jQuery mobile also are put into produce the swipe perception. Additionally, the fresh new “toastr” collection could be provided to display the fresh new notification in the software. Be sure to provide some traditional files, that happen to be said throughout the more than parts, such as auth.js, config.js, util.js. The brand new list.js file would be discussed in the after the area.
The brand new List.js File
It file will take obligations to have proving acceptance into the authenticated affiliate on heading, exhibiting the menu of required pages for instance the swipe consequences, appearing the list of family relations, carrying out a complement consult, accepting the new complimentary requests, handling the logic whenever clicking on this new “Logout” switch and you will integrating new chat element and sound/films contacting. A complete supply code can be obtained right here.
The brand new Header
We have to inform you anticipate to your validated user to your header. For doing that, we will get the advice of your authenticated user throughout the regional shop then display that information on the latest header.
Advised Profiles
We’re strengthening a dating website. Thus, we must let you know the menu of recommended users for the latest associate. As previously mentioned just before, the list of necessary profiles cannot have coordinating needs to your most recent representative. After that, the gender of each representative are going to be contrary to the present owner’s sex. To obtain the selection of recommended profiles, we have to call the brand new highly recommend member API. You might consider the code snippet below for more information.